Dorothy Conway, 89, formerly of Leesburg, Florida went to be with the Lord on October 24, 2021 at Hospice of Palm Beach County in the Gerstenberg Hospice Center, Located in Trustbridge in West Palm Beach, Florida under the loving care of her Family and Staff of Hospice. Dorothy was born on March 23, 1932 in Nocatee, Florida to her parents David Yarbrough and Malzie (Daniels) Yarbrough.

She and her late husband James moved to Leesburg in 1981 from Belle Glade, Florida. James and Dorothy were the owners of The Western Auto Store in Leesburg from 1981 to 1994. She was a very devoted member of The First Baptist Church of Leesburg and was active in the church and its outreach ministries. Dorothy loved to work and spend time with her family, especially her grandchildren. She was also a former member of the First Baptist Church in Belle Glade.

She is survived by her two loving children: David Conway and his wife Lisa of Birmingham, Al and Cindy Lutz and her husband Wally of Wellington, FL; five grandchildren: Katie Wohlwend and her husband Jonathan, Bayly Conway, Chad Lutz, Emily Ames and her husband Joe and Jason Belt; two great-grandchildren: Charlie Wohlwend and Dottie Wohlwend. Dorothy was preceded in death by her parents, a beloved son, Mike Conway, her beloved husband, James Conway, two brothers, Doyal Yarbrough and Otis Yarbrough and a sister, Opal Davis.

Funeral Services will be held on Saturday, October 30, 2021 at 12:00PM (Noon) at The First Baptist Church of Leesburg in the Chapel with Pastor Charles Roesel officiating. A visitation will be held prior to the service from 11:00AM till the hour of service in the chapel. She will be laid to rest following the service at Hillcrest Memorial Gardens, Leesburg, Fl.

The family has requested donations be made to the Christian Care Center in care of The First Baptist Church of Leesburg at 220 North 13th Street Leesburg, FL 34748 in Dorothy’s loving memory.
